PSS Systems offers an off-the-shelf legal holds software application.  It manages the process of scoping holds, issuing notices and reminders, interviewing employees, and conducting collections for in-house legal people.  It is used by companies such as Citigroup, TD Bank, First Data Corp, Halliburton and other large companies.  The software is called Atlas LCC (litigation communications and collections) and it follows the Zubulake Checklist as the process model. Good morning folks,

I am doing research for a paper on hold order management systems and have
already been to the RecMgmt archive.  Is anyone out there using an automated
(electronic) system and is it a custom application or a modification of a
commercial-off-the-shelf software package?  Does it integrate with other
software used to manage records/documents in any medium?  What
best-practices are you using to ensure that holds are properly applied and
maintained for the length of the litigation?
